网络流量识别如何处理大数据?
在当今信息爆炸的时代,网络流量识别成为大数据处理的重要环节。如何高效、准确地处理海量网络流量数据,对于提升网络服务质量、保障网络安全具有重要意义。本文将深入探讨网络流量识别在处理大数据方面的策略与技巧。
一、网络流量识别概述
网络流量识别是指通过对网络数据包进行分析,识别出数据包的来源、类型、目的、传输速率等信息。在处理大数据时,网络流量识别需要面对以下几个挑战:
- 数据量庞大:随着互联网的快速发展,网络流量数据量呈指数级增长,对处理能力提出了更高要求。
- 数据类型多样:网络流量数据包括文本、图片、音频、视频等多种类型,需要针对不同类型数据进行识别和处理。
- 实时性要求高:网络流量识别需要实时处理数据,以满足实时监控、预警等需求。
二、网络流量识别处理大数据的策略
- 数据采集与预处理
(1)数据采集:通过部署网络流量采集设备,如探针、交换机等,采集网络流量数据。
(2)数据预处理:对采集到的数据进行清洗、去重、去噪等操作,提高数据质量。
- 特征提取
(1)文本特征提取:针对文本数据,提取关键词、主题、情感等特征。
(2)图像特征提取:针对图像数据,提取颜色、纹理、形状等特征。
(3)音频特征提取:针对音频数据,提取音调、音色、节奏等特征。
- 分类与聚类
(1)分类:根据数据特征,将数据划分为不同的类别,如正常流量、恶意流量等。
(2)聚类:将具有相似特征的数据归为一类,如将同一用户在不同时间段的流量归为一类。
- 异常检测
(1)基于规则:根据预先设定的规则,检测异常流量。
(2)基于机器学习:利用机器学习算法,如支持向量机、神经网络等,识别异常流量。
三、案例分析
以某大型企业为例,其网络流量数据量达到每天数十亿条。通过以下步骤处理大数据:
数据采集与预处理:部署探针采集网络流量数据,进行清洗、去重、去噪等操作。
特征提取:针对不同类型数据,提取关键词、主题、颜色、纹理等特征。
分类与聚类:将数据划分为正常流量、恶意流量等类别,将相似流量归为一类。
异常检测:利用机器学习算法,识别异常流量。
通过以上步骤,企业成功实现了对海量网络流量数据的处理,提高了网络安全防护能力。
四、总结
网络流量识别在处理大数据方面具有重要作用。通过数据采集与预处理、特征提取、分类与聚类、异常检测等策略,可以有效应对大数据带来的挑战。随着技术的不断发展,网络流量识别在处理大数据方面的应用将越来越广泛。
猜你喜欢:网络流量采集